Google Dominates – Over 96% of the Search Market

Google holds more than 96% of the UAE search market, making it the only search engine that truly matters for your business. On mobile devices, where over 98% of searches start, Google's share reaches 98‑99%. Unlike Western markets where Bing or DuckDuckGo have meaningful shares, in the UAE, optimising for Google is non‑negotiable. Other engines collectively account for less than 4% of traffic – we focus exclusively on Google to maximise your return.

For UAE e‑commerce, the total market is projected to reach AED 127 billion in 2025, with search driving 53% of all website traffic. Every technical fix, content decision, and link‑building campaign must be built for Google's UAE algorithm – not a diluted “global” approach.

Bilingual Search: Arabic + English are Non‑Negotiable

68% of the UAE population are expatriates, but Arabic remains the official language and the language of trust. A brand that only targets English speakers leaves almost a third of the market untapped – and misses high‑intent Arabic commercial queries that often have less competition. Voice search in Arabic is exploding: 71% of UAE residents use voice search daily, and the majority of those queries are in Arabic.

Bilingual SEO requires separate keyword research for Arabic (ar‑AE) and English queries, proper hreflang implementation (`/en/` and `/ar/` subdirectories), and culturally nuanced content that resonates with local audiences. Mobile‑First is UAE‑First – 98% of Searches Start on Mobile

The UAE is one of the most mobile‑connected nations on earth, with 21.9 million active mobile connections in early 2025 – equivalent to 195% of the total population. Over 98% of search queries begin on a mobile device, and the average monthly mobile data usage is expected to grow from 12.9GB in 2025 to 35GB by 2030.

Core Web Vitals are not optional – they are the baseline. Google's mobile‑first indexing means your site's mobile version determines your rankings. The Local Pack Captures the Most Valuable Real Estate in the UAE

For service businesses in Dubai, Abu Dhabi, Sharjah, and across the emirates, the Google Map Pack is the single most important section of search results – driving 60‑80% of all high‑intent commercial traffic. Yet most businesses still treat local SEO as an afterthought, leaving the most valuable real estate to competitors.

Google's local algorithm evaluates your Google Business Profile (GBP) completeness, review quantity and recency, citation consistency (NAP), proximity to the searcher, and engagement signals (calls, direction requests, website clicks). Businesses with active, well‑optimised GBPs consistently outrank those with larger domain authority but neglected local profiles. A proper UAE bilingual SEO implementation uses separate URLs for English and Arabic versions (subdirectory structure `/en/` and `/ar/` recommended), hreflang annotations with `en‑AE` and `ar‑AE` language codes (never just `en` or `ar`), canonical tags on each version, and separate keyword research for each language. Missing or broken hreflang is the single most common technical issue on UAE bilingual websites.

PDPL (Federal Decree‑Law No. 45 of 2021) is the UAE's data protection law, modelled on GDPR. It affects SEO directly through email capture, newsletter signups, gated content downloads, and any form of automated follow‑up from organic traffic. Non‑compliance can result in fines up to AED 5 million or more, depending on the violation. We build PDPL‑ready compliance into every campaign – express consent workflows, transparent privacy policies, and data protection impact assessments.
Yes – the UAE Media Council announced the mandatory Advertiser Permit in July 2025 for anyone publishing promotional content across social media, websites, or apps operating in the UAE. This includes both paid and unpaid promotional content (e.g., blog posts, case studies, or even social media captions that promote your business).
